This issue seems only to happen on machines that were upgraded from very old openSUSE releases; but looking at the screens 'as user' seems not to imply anything going wrong.
Thus, please review this test failure and the module - likely there are invalid needles in play, giving wrong indications as to how to continue with the execution
We have strange condition
```
until (get_var('YAST_SW_NO_SUMMARY')) {
assert_screen ['yast2-sw-packages-autoselected', 'yast2-sw_automatic-changes', 'yast2-sw_shows_summary'], 60;
```
And seems that variable is set somewhere in other test module
